      Subpart B_Voluntary Conversion of Public Housing Developments

 

Sec.  972.212  Timing of voluntary conversion.



    (a) A PHA may proceed to convert a development covered by a 

conversion plan only after receiving written approval of the conversion 

plan from HUD. This approval will be separate from the approval that the 

PHA receives for its PHA Annual Plan. A PHA may apply for tenant-based 

assistance in accordance with Section 8 program requirements and will be 

given priority for receiving tenant-based assistance to replace the 

public housing units.

    (b) A PHA may not demolish or dispose of units or property until 

completion of the required environmental review under part 58 of this 

title (if a Responsible Entity has assumed environmental responsibility 

for the project) or part 50 of this title (if HUD is performing the 

environmental review). Further, HUD will not approve a conversion plan 

until completion of the required environmental review. However, before 

completion of the environmental review, HUD may approve the targeted 

units for deprogramming and may authorize the PHA to undertake other 

activities proposed in the conversion plan that do not require 

environmental review (such as certain activities related to the 

relocation of residents), as long as the buildings in question are 

adequately secured and maintained.

    (c) For purposes of determining operating subsidy eligibility, the 

submitted conversion plan will be considered the equivalent of a formal 

request to remove dwelling units from the PHA's inventory and Annual 

Contributions Contract (ACC). Units that are vacant or are vacated on or 

after the written notification date will be treated as approved for 

deprogramming under Sec.  990.108(b)(1) of this title, and will also be 

provided the phase down of subsidy pursuant to Sec.  990.114 of this 

title.

    (d) HUD may require that funding for the initial year of tenant-

based assistance be provided from the public housing Capital Fund, 

Operating Fund, or both.
